What happens if children have thrombocytopenia?

Children are active by nature. When they are outdoors, they may accidentally bump into things and get bruises on their bodies. Parents may not pay much attention to this. If purple and red spots appear on the child's skin and there has been no recent bumps or collisions, parents should press to see if the bruises will fade away. If they do not, it may be caused by thrombocytopenia. Parents need to observe whether their children have other abnormal signs and take them to the hospital for examination if necessary.

Low platelet count in children is an autoimmune bleeding disease, clinically called thrombocytopenic purpura, also known as thrombocytopenia. To solve the problem of low platelets, we must first know what causes low platelets in children. Different causes require different treatments. Do you know what causes thrombocytopenic purpura?

1. Platelet-related antibodies

Antiplatelet antibodies are present in the serum of patients with chronic ITP. If the plasma of chronic ITP patients is transfused to normal people, the platelets of normal people may be reduced; if the platelets of normal people are transfused to ITP patients, the transfused platelets will be destroyed in a short time.

2. Megakaryocyte or mature disorder

In life, what are the causes of thrombocytopenic purpura? Because platelets and megakaryocytes have common antigens, anti-platelet antibodies can also inhibit bone marrow megakaryocytes, causing their maturation disorders, thereby affecting platelet production and causing thrombocytopenia.

3. Platelet destruction mechanism

The average lifespan of normal platelets is 7 to 11 days, while the lifespan of platelets in ITP patients is 230 minutes. Because the spleen contains a large number of macrophages that can produce high concentrations of anti-platelet antibodies, and slow blood flow can hinder the destruction of platelets by antibodies, the spleen becomes the main site of platelet destruction. The liver and kidney medulla are also sites of platelet destruction.

4. Other factors

Effect of estrogen: The chronic type is more common in older women and is prone to relapse during pregnancy, suggesting that estrogen may play a certain role in the onset of this disease. It may be that sex hormones increase the ability of macrophages to phagocytize and destroy platelets; antibodies damage capillary endothelial cells, causing increased capillary permeability and aggravating bleeding.
